Retro fridge freezers are an excellent way to bring an element of character and style to your kitchen. They are usually shaped like 1950s-style fridges and come in a variety of vibrant colors. They can add a unique touch to country kitchens or bring a nostalgic feel to modern rooms.

The brand that best captures the retro fridge freezer uk style is Smeg and is known for their gorgeous fridge freezers that feature chrome trim and bright colors. There are Smeg fridge freezers in a variety of sizes and styles, such as compact, tall narrow and side-by-side.

Another manufacturer to offer a variety of retro-style, vibrant fridges is Montpellier, which has both small and large models. This stylish Montpellier retro fridge freezer RF603N4RDUK is an excellent example of a model that can be incorporated into the majority of kitchen color schemes. It has a generous capacity of 244 litres which is equivalent to 13 bags of groceries and also has a drawer to store salad greens. Other features include an inverter compressor for energy efficiency, and a handy "quick freeze" mode to speed up the process of making ice.

Its Retropolitan collection is available in buttercup, beach blue, yellow cherry red, jadeite green, orange, pink lemonade, and turquoise. If none of these colors appeal to you You can request one with a custom color for an additional $400 fee.

There are also budget-friendly options, like this 210-litre retro fridge by Amica. The blue hue of the fridge will stand out in any kitchen. It also features an impressively spacious interior, featuring three safety glass shelves as well as two balconies with doors, and the salad crisper. It comes with an A+ rating for energy efficiency and a manual defrost refrigerator, and an auto defrost.

The freezer of your fridge does not have to blend in. It could be a focal point in your kitchen if you choose an old-fashioned style. These styles are reminiscent of refrigerators produced in the 1950s. They're made to be a bold and vibrant and distinctive, with features such as the curved edges and large handles. These models are available in a variety of bright colors including orange, green, blue and red.

Smeg is the leader in the market with a variety of styles and finishes. Their iconic revival fridges feature vibrant colors, such as blue, red and orange, and are aimed at those who appreciate nostalgic items as well as those who appreciate design. With a range of handles and interior finishes, you can select the perfect Smeg fridge that will suit your style preferences.

Gorenje is another brand that has an impressive selection of retro refrigerators. Their stunning RF60309 is a perfect example of how these fridges combine timeless design with 21st-century technology. This fridge is a beautiful addition to any kitchen. It has an A+ energy rating.
